Why go
Tabelog 100-listed gelateria inside Tokyo Solamachi, named for its pasteurization temperature and built around high-butterfat Tomo dairy. Counter-service only, under ¥1,000 per serving, open daily 10 AM–9 PM. Best for a quick post-Skytree stop rather than a sit-down dessert destination.

Restaurant context
Tomo Rakunou 63℃ and Gion Tsujiri Toukyou sukaitsurii taun soramachi ten share the same Solamachi complex and nearly identical price bands (both under ¥2,000), but Gion Tsujiri pivots hard into matcha-forward builds where Tomo Rakunou 63℃ keeps dairy front and center. If you prefer green tea intensity over milk clarity, Gion Tsujiri wins; for plain gelato that tastes like the farm it came from, Tomo Rakunou 63℃ justifies the Tabelog nod. Both accept walk-ins with no reservations, so booking difficulty is identical, choose based on flavor preference, not logistics.
Yakitori Omino operates at ¥¥¥, roughly triple Tomo Rakunou 63℃'s price point, requires advance booking for dinner; it's a different category (yakitori versus gelato) but shares the Oshiage neighborhood. If you're planning a meal around Skytree, pair yakitori at Omino with gelato at Tomo Rakunou 63℃ as a lower-cost closer. Tamahide offers chicken-focused meals nearby, while KOKYU delivers contemporary plated desserts at ¥¥¥; both require more time and budget than Tomo Rakunou 63℃'s quick counter service. For the easiest, cheapest Tabelog-backed dessert in the Solamachi cluster, Tomo Rakunou 63℃ is the default, but expect to eat standing or walking, not seated.
